This morning I went to a local little lake where many swallows are gathering.
I took about 6000 pictures in 2 hours time. All handheld. Weather was cloudy and very much wind. At some point the strong wind was handsome because it sometimes slowed down the flight speed.
As the main problem was to keep the fast-moving birds in the viewfinder at 400mm, -with the bird as close as possible-, there were approx 1000 pictures with a complete swallow in the image.
From those 1000, approx 65% were in focus with clear feather detail.
Because of the high speed they're flying, I shot exclusive 1/8000/sec
Among those, some were captured quite close.nUnderneath one of those, with 100% crop & EXIF pasted.
The main image is as it came straight out of the camera, no PP, no additional sharpening.
Image taken in raw and converted in dpp4. Shadow lift +2
